We hear God speak every time we open the Bible. Often times we are
convicted over some sin or sinful direction we are heading. When this
occurs, we do not have to seek further counsel. God’s voice is unmistakable.
I wish this was always the case. God’s Word is clear regarding knowing and
pleasing God, but sometimes direction in where to invest our time, efforts,
and resources must be spiritually discerned. We know what must be done,
but we struggle with how to proceed. Anyone who has been listening to my
sermons over the past several years can easily see the Lord has been dealing
with me in the area of disciple-making. I believe we have many committed
disciples in our church. They have greatly benefitted from the teachings of
the church, have learned to serve by serving alongside others, and have given
sacrificially to the work of the church because they believe in her mission.
While these things are true about many, I think we have done a poor job of
casting the vision for Biblical discipleship and a process for seeing it take
place. Consequently, I believe we have not consistently produced missional,
reproducing disciples. God has been revealing this to me and burdening me
for the ministry of disciple-making with increasing intensity over the past
couple of years. I have become so convicted that I believe setting any goal for
myself or our church lower than making authentic, Christ-following,
reproducing disciples would be disobedient to the call of Jesus Christ.
The Biblical mandate to make disciples in Matthew 28:18-20 does not fully
explain all of the intricacies of the disciple-making process, but the example
of our Lord Jesus makes several things clear.
1.	 Jesus saw the need to call out a small group to become disciples. He
ministered to the masses, but He invited a few to come and follow. These
were the ones that were to carry on His work.
2.	 He taught them the deep things of God. He interacted with them and
allowed them to ask questions. They were given insight about His person
and mission that others were not.
3.	 He allowed them to have a deep, close relationship with Him. They
lived with Him and observed Him. He was there for them and was the
ultimate example for them.
4.	 He let them participate in the ministry. The disciples preached,
healed, helped, brought people to Jesus, and had different responsibilities
within the group. Sometimes they succeeded and He rejoiced with them.
Sometimes it was necessary for Him to rebuke and correct them.
5.	 He trusted and released them to carry on (complete) the mission.
When I evaluated our present discipleship strategy in light of Jesus’ example,
I found two glaring weaknesses: expectation and accountability. You cannot
genuinely have one without the other. We hold up the standards of scripture
as our expectation, but do we consistently hold one another accountable
according to that standard? We know we are to be living sacrifices (Romans
12:1) but seldom confront attitudes of blatant selfishness. We know we are
to hide God’s Word in our hearts (Psalm 119:11) but we are unwilling to ask
each other in Sunday School to recite a memory verse. These are just two
simple examples.
Last year I sent a letter out to 28 young men in our church inviting them to
enter into a small group discipleship study with high expectations and high
accountability. I asked them to make a 6 month commitment to the study
and process. I knew the stresses of life would keep many of these men from
making this commitment, but eight made the commitment. They did their
work, memorized memory verses, and faithfully attended the group. It has
been amazing to see these guys grow and draw closer to the Lord. God has
also birthed a desire in them to fulfill the Great Commission by leading
others on the same effort. Seven of those men are praying the Lord would
use them to lead other groups. There is an open letter to our church on page
11 of the Bridge. Prayerfully consider whether the Lord might want you to
become part of one of these small groups, that the foundation may be laid
in your own life for becoming the authentic, Christ-following, reproducing
disciple the Lord would have you to be.

The “Voices of LC” is a 12
member ensemble that serves
as a public relations group for
Louisiana College located in
Pineville, Louisiana. “Voices”
also serves as a worship team
for chapel services and other
events at the college.
Organized in the fall of 2007,
originally to sing one song for
a banquet, the group has
travelled extensively in
Louisiana and such states as
Arizona, Florida, Georgia,
Indiana, Kentucky,
Mississippi, Missouri, and
Tennessee. In the summer of
2008, the group was
privileged to sing at the
Southern Baptist Convention
in Indianapolis.
“Voices” was commissioned
by the Louisiana Baptist
Convention to create a
musical for a state-wide
initiative calling for prayer
and revival entitled “Awaken
2012.” The group recorded its
first cd Awaken in the studios
of Community Bible Church
in San Antonio, December of
2011.
Awaken was premiered at the
Louisiana Baptist Evangelism
Conference on January 24,
2012.
The group is made up of a
very diverse group of
majors including, Music,
Social Work, Education, and
Business. Dr. Fred Guilbert
(who is a friend and
fellow-graduate of LC with
Bro. Butch) is the director of
the group and comes from a
background of over 40 years
of ministry in church music.

The Long Rang Planning committee has a
question for you. How effective is the Church
today relative to 30 years ago? Think about it
for a minute before you read on. How do you
judge “effectiveness”? Is it a look inside the
Church at our programs, or is it a look outside
the Church at our impact on the world? Surely
the answer includes some of both as we are
commanded to worship, fellowship, and
minister to one another while also we are called
to “go,” “make disciples,” and “be a witness” to
the world.
It is safe to assume that we can agree that we
do a great job internally, but what about our
impact on the world? Here are a few
Washington Parish statistics that bring home
the reality:
A) In 1980, 86% of residents claimed affiliation
with an Evangelical Protestant church, while
only 42% make the claim in 2010. Further, in
1980 virtually 100% of residents claimed
affiliation with some church, while in
2010 43% claim they have no church affiliation.
B) In 2013, 63% of births were to unwed
mothers.
C) In 2012, 24% of households were headed by
single parents.
This indicates there are great needs in our area
of Washington Parish.
The Long Range Planning committee is studying
the commandments given us in scripture to
determine how best to fulfill our God given
purpose to minister inside and outside the
Church. We will be including the Church body
in this discussion later this Summer.
Please be in prayer for the committee, our
church as a whole, and for yourself that the
Holy Spirit would give us a heart for His people
and lead us in better fulfilling his commands.

	 Accountability is one of the
most vital yet often most neglected
components of the growth of
disciples. As I look back over my
own spiritual development, the
greatest strides were made during
times of intense accountability.
These were times when I knew I
would be asked about how much
time I spent in prayer and Bible
study. I would be asked about my
progress in overcoming certain
persistent sins in my life, etc…
This level of accountability is not
possible through most Sunday
school classes. Most of our classes
are not gender specific and they
are open groups. Open groups are
those that welcome all who might
show up. This is a
wonderful thing, and Sunday
school offers a great entry-point
for discipleship and connection
to the local Body, but it is not the
in-depth discipleship many are
hungry to find. I want you to
prayerfully consider whether the
Lord might want you to go deeper.
	 If you think an intense
discipleship study that will force
you to go much deeper in your
walk with the Lord is something
the Lord is calling you to, I want
you to know exactly what you are
getting into and to be fully
committed. This small group
study will last 25 weeks. Here
are the expectations for the
attendants:
1.	 ATTEND:
Participants are expected to
attend the 1 to 1 1/2 hour weekly
meeting unless providentially
hindered.
2.	 DO THE WORK:
Each week there will be a lesson
that will have three components:
memory verse study, Bible study
with discussion questions, and a
reading with discussion questions.
This study will take approximately
1 ½ hours. This is to be completed
prior to the Bible Study each week.
3.	 SUBMIT TO
ACCOUNTABILITY:
Each person will have an
accountability partner. This
person will pray for you daily, call
you if you miss a meeting and
ask you why you were not there,
listen to you recite your memory
verse, and look at your book. The
accountability will grow beyond
these things, but this is where we
will start.
4.	 HAVE A DESIRE TO GROW
TO BE A MORE PLEASING
FOLLOWER OF JESUS CHRIST!
There will be numerous time
options to choose from for
participants. We will set these
times once we can gauge the
numbers wanting to participate
and the availability of our leaders.
If this is something you are
interested in, please e-mail who
or sign up on the bulletin board
outside the Family Life Center. If
you have questions, I will be glad
to answer them. I will not be
following up on this letter. The
ball is now in your court.
